Multiply.
(5x+3)(5x - 3)
A. 25x2 + 9
B. 25x2 + 30x-9
c. 25x2 – 30x- 9
D. 25x2 - 9

Answer:

D

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

(5x + 3)(5x - 3)

Each term in the second factor is multiplied by each term in the first factor, that is

5x(5x - 3) + 3(5x - 3) ← distribute both parenthesis

= 25x² - 15x + 15x - 9 ← collect like terms

= 25x² - 9 → D
